    Hey guys,

    I picked up a pair of the 2017 black tss wheels for my platinum but didn't get the lugs.

    Does anyone know if the lugs on the platinum wheels will match up with the black tss wheels just fine?

    Why not wrench a lug off the Platinum wheel and see if the wheel stud hole resembles the TSS wheel stud hole. They should be milled the same angle for your existing lug to work....

    That did the trick. I actually called parts at the dealership I got the truck from and he told me that the ones that come on the 1794/platinum replaced the others after the lug nut recall.
